Swimming coach suspended


CHENNAI: Veerabhadran, attached to Sports Development Authority of Tamil Nadu and official coach at Velachery Swimming Pool, was suspended on December 10, for allegedly misbehaving with a 11-year-old girl triathlete.

Veerabhadran is a familiar name in swimming circles for he was the man behind triathlete champion C Amutha's success in her early days. But, of late, it is learnt that there has been a lot of whispering about the coach's handling of his wards. It is learnt that the girl's parents had first informed Solomon, Sports Officer at the swimming pool, but he seemed to have taken the issue lightly. Finally, a written complaint reached the hands of the Member Secretary of SDAT, who ordered an oral inquiry before issuing the suspension order.

The suspension letter has been sent by registered post and the outcome is to be known in two weeks' time, according to SDAT sources.
